AJ06 SHA is a 2006 Kia Sportage in Black with a 1,991c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.
Across all 2006 Kia Sportage models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.4% with a typical mileage of 78,394 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Sportage f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 16,003 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AJ06 SHA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Sportage typ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 20 years old, this Kia Sportage is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
